This is great Greg. This is exactly the best way to get better on guitar. Playing with other people exposes weak areas and gives you a way to learn new things firsthand. You've got the first step down here... you've identified a weak area. Now we just have to focus on that weak area for a good chunk of time. If you haven't started The Strumming Dr. course yet, I would recommend going through it. It's not just about strumming but timing too. I had the same experience as you multiple times. Playing in your room by yourself is pretty easy. It's kind of like singing in the shower. It sounds great! But when you get around other people where the tempo and time are dictated by an outside force, it can be tough to get control over those areas.
